Abstract
We determine the resonant substructure of D0K decays using a five-dimensional maximum-likelihood technique to extract the relative fractions and phases of the amplitudes contributing to this final state. We find that two-body decay modes account for at least 76% of all decays. We obtain branching ratios for several decay modes including B(D0K-a1+) =(9.0±0.9±1. 7)%, B(D0K»0*0)=(1.9±0.3±0.7)%, and B(D0K1(1270)) =(1.8±0.5 ±0.8)%. For the decay mode D0K»0*0, the K» *0 and 0 are found to be polarized with their spins oriented in the direction of their motion as seen from the D0 frame.
